科学仪器的发展与基因组研究
Impacts of Progress in Scientific Instruments on Genome Approach
【摘要】 遗传学是一门年轻的科学 ,但发展迅速 ,到了 2 0世纪末更迎来了可对某种生物的整个基因体系的结构、功能进行研究的基因组时代。遗传学及基因组学的整个研究进程中都得益于科学仪器的相应发展 ,特别是在某些关键阶段 ,例如人类全基因组测序项目之得以顺利展开及即将提前完成 ,就是一个得益于相应科学仪器的发展的良好范例。本文对在基因组及后基因组研究中科学仪器的使用及发展 ,从规模化测序、功能性基因组学、遗传多态性及结构基因组学等方面做了概括的介绍 ,并简要展望了其进一步的发展。
【Abstract】 Genetics is a young branch of biology with impressive progress. By the end of twenty century we have seen the genome era, which overlooks the whole genetic structure and function, was coming. The achievements of genetics and genomics have benefited from the development of scientific instruments, especially at certain key stages of progress. A good example is the project of whole human genome sequencing. It should be no possible to get success without the rapid improvement of DNA sequencer. In this review, we summarized the impacts of the progress in scientific instruments on genome approach, including industry-scale DNA sequencing, functional genomics, polymorphism and structural genomics. A brief prospect was also made.
